笔试练习8.1 VBA- 答案

时间:2022-11-21 19:17:00 综合指导 我要投稿
  • 相关推荐

笔试练习8.1 VBA- 答案

  VBA1 答案

笔试练习8.1 VBA- 答案

  2005.4(30)

  以下可以得到“2*5=10”结果的VBA表达式为

  A) “2*5”&“=”&2*5 B) “2*5”+“=”+2*5 C) 2*5&“=”&2*5 D) 2*5+“=”+2*5

  字符串常量加双引号,数值不加双引号

  &连接符与+连接符的区别,&强制连接,可以用于字符串与数字之间;+只能连接两个字符串

  2005.4(33) 以

  下程序段运行后,消息框的输出结果是

  a=sqr(3)

  b=sqr(2)

  c=a>bc为true,即-1

  Msgbox c+2

  A) -1 B) 1 C) 2 D) 出错

  2005.9(31) 下列逻辑表达式中,能正确表示条件“x和y都是奇数”的是

  A)x Mod 2 =1 Or y Mod 2 =1 B)x Mod 2 =0 Or y Mod 2=0

  C)x Mod 2 =1 And y Mod 2 =1 D)x Mod 2 =0 And y Mod 2=0

  2005.9(填8) 函数Now( )返回值的含义是

  2006.4(29) VBA程序的多条语句可以写在一行中,其分隔符必须使用符号

  A.: B.’ C.; D.,

  2006.4(30) VBA表达式3*3\3/3的输出结果是

  A.0 B.1 C.3 D.9

  符号优先级:加减号 < mod < \ < 乘号、除号

  (

  8.1PPT)

  2006.9(25) 在已建雇员表中有“工作日期”字段,下图所示的是以此表为数据源创建的“雇员基本信息”窗体。

  假设当前雇员的工作日期为“1998-08-17”,若在窗体“工作日期”标签右侧文本框控件的

  1 / 3

  VBA1 答案

  “控件来源”属性中输入表达式:=Str(Month([工作日期]))+”月”,则在该文本框控件内显示的结果是

  Month year day这些函数返回的值是数值类型,数值只有1/2/3没有01/02/03;

  Str函数将数值8转换为字符串:“ 8”(前面有一个空格)

  +把两个字符串连接到一起

  A)Str(Month(Date( )))+”月” B)”08”+”月”

  2006.9(30) (30)在窗体中添加一个命令按钮(名称为Command1),然后编写如下代码:

  Private Sub Command1_Click( )

  a=0: b=5: c=6 C)08月 D)8月

  MsgBox a=b+c

  End Sub

  窗体打开运行后,如果单击命令按钮,则消息框的输出结果是

  A)11

  2007.4(11)在VBA编程中检测字符串长度的函数名是

  2007.9(29) 使用Function语句定义一个函数过程,其返回值的类型______。

  A)只能是符号常量 B)是除数组之外的简单数据类型 C)可在调用时由运行过程决定 D)由函数定义时As子句声明 B)a=11 C)0 D)False

  2008.4(29) 语句Dim NewArray(10) As Interger的含义是

  A>定义了一个整整变量且初值为10 B>定义了10个整数构成的数组

  C>定义了11个整数构成的数组 D>将数组的第10元素设置为整整

  下标下限,缺省为0 2008.9(30)在 Access 中,如果

  VBA1 答案

  2005.4(30)

  以下可以得到“2*5=10”结果的VBA表达式为

  A) “2*5”&“=”&2*5 B) “2*5”+“=”+2*5 C) 2*5&“=”&2*5 D) 2*5+“=”+2*5

  字符串常量加双引号,数值不加双引号

  &连接符与+连接符的区别,&强制连接,可以用于字符串与数字之间;+只能连接两个字符串

  2005.4(33) 以

  下程序段运行后,消息框的输出结果是

  a=sqr(3)

  b=sqr(2)

  c=a>bc为true,即-1

  Msgbox c+2

  A) -1 B) 1 C) 2 D) 出错

  2005.9(31) 下列逻辑表达式中,能正确表示条件“x和y都是奇数”的是

  A)x Mod 2 =1 Or y Mod 2 =1 B)x Mod 2 =0 Or y Mod 2=0

  C)x Mod 2 =1 And y Mod 2 =1 D)x Mod 2 =0 And y Mod 2=0

  2005.9(填8) 函数Now( )返回值的含义是

  2006.4(29) VBA程序的多条语句可以写在一行中,其分隔符必须使用符号

  A.: B.’ C.; D.,

  2006.4(30) VBA表达式3*3\3/3的输出结果是

  A.0 B.1 C.3 D.9

  符号优先级:加减号 < mod < \ < 乘号、除号

  (

  8.1PPT)

  2006.9(25) 在已建雇员表中有“工作日期”字段,下图所示的是以此表为数据源创建的“雇员基本信息”窗体。

  假设当前雇员的工作日期为“1998-08-17”,若在窗体“工作日期”标签右侧文本框控件的

  1 / 3

  VBA1 答案

  “控件来源”属性中输入表达式:=Str(Month([工作日期]))+”月”,则在该文本框控件内显示的结果是

  Month year day这些函数返回的值是数值类型,数值只有1/2/3没有01/02/03;

  Str函数将数值8转换为字符串:“ 8”(前面有一个空格)

  +把两个字符串连接到一起

  A)Str(Month(Date( )))+”月” B)”08”+”月”

  2006.9(30) (30)在窗体中添加一个命令按钮(名称为Command1),然后编写如下代码:

  Private Sub Command1_Click( )

  a=0: b=5: c=6 C)08月 D)8月

  MsgBox a=b+c

  End Sub

  窗体打开运行后,如果单击命令按钮,则消息框的输出结果是

  A)11

  2007.4(11)在VBA编程中检测字符串长度的函数名是

  2007.9(29) 使用Function语句定义一个函数过程,其返回值的类型______。

  A)只能是符号常量 B)是除数组之外的简单数据类型 C)可在调用时由运行过程决定 D)由函数定义时As子句声明 B)a=11 C)0 D)False

  2008.4(29) 语句Dim NewArray(10) As Interger的含义是

  A>定义了一个整整变量且初值为10 B>定义了10个整数构成的数组

  C>定义了11个整数构成的数组 D>将数组的第10元素设置为整整

  下标下限,缺省为0 2008.9(30)在 Access 中,如果变量定义在模块的过程内部,当过程代码执行时才可见,则这种变量的作用域为( )。

  A)程序范围 B)全局范围

  C)模块范围 D)局部范围

  局部范围:在模块的过程内部,用Dim、StaticAs定义;作用域在过程内

  模块范围:在模块的通用说明区,用Dim、Static、PrivateAS定义;作用域包含模块中的所有过程和函数

  2 / 3

  VBA1 答案

  全局范围:在模块的通用说明区中,用public?As/Global定义,所有的类模块和标准模块的范围都可见

  2009.9(30)下列程数据类型中,不属于VBA的是:

  A)长整型 B)布尔型 C)变体型 D)指针型

  2009.9(31) 下列数组声明语句中,正确的是

  A) Dim A [3,4] As Integer B) Dim A (3,4) As Integer

  C) Dim A [3;4] As Integer D) Dim A (3;4) As Integer

  2009.9(填9) 在VBA中求字符串的长度可以使用函数 。

  2009.9(填10)要将正实数x保留两位小数,若采用Int 函数完成,则表达式为。

  3 / 3

  变量定义在模块的过程内部,当过程代码执行时才可见,则这种变量的作用域为( )。

  A)程序范围 B)全局范围

  C)模块范围 D)局部范围

  局部范围:在模块的过程内部,用Dim、StaticAs定义;作用域在过程内

  模块范围:在模块的通用说明区,用Dim、Static、PrivateAS定义;作用域包含模块中的所有过程和函数

  2 / 3

  VBA1 答案

  全局范围:在模块的通用说明区中,用public?As/Global定义,所有的类模块和标准模块的范围都可见

  2009.9(30)下列程数据类型中,不属于VBA的是:

  A)长整型 B)布尔型 C)变体型 D)指针型

  2009.9(31) 下列数组声明语句中,正确的是

  A) Dim A [3,4] As Integer B) Dim A (3,4) As Integer

  C) Dim A [3;4] As Integer D) Dim A (3;4) As Integer

  2009.9(填9) 在VBA中求字符串的长度可以使用函数 。

  2009.9(填10)要将正实数x保留两位小数,若采用Int 函数完成,则表达式为。

 


【笔试练习8.1 VBA- 答案】相关文章:

笔试练习8.1 VBA08-10

笔试练习5(报表) 与答案08-10

oracle笔试题及答案08-16

java笔试题及答案07-28

人事专员笔试题及答案08-16

编导笔试题目及答案08-16

报社笔试题目及答案09-19

文秘笔试题目及答案08-16

2017华为笔试题及答案08-07

经典java笔试题及答案分享08-10